What a surprise to find this in the city of Bangkok: it is affectionately called the Crocodile Temple, Wat Chakrawat has three live crocodiles that live in an outdoor enclosed area you can view. They are pretty large and at first we wondered if they were real. Then they moved - Yes, definitely real. Quite bizarre why they're even there, but a nice interesting surprise nevertheless.
